Immerse yourself in the 800-year-old ancient village's autumn drying scenery and everyday life

✨ Trip Highlights · A century-old poetic "Autumn Drying" scene: Every September, villagers hang seasonal crops like red chili peppers, yellow corn, and rice under eaves and on windowsills. The bright colors contrast beautifully with the yellow walls and black tiles of the Ming and Qing dynasty architecture, creating a stunning harvest tableau perfect for photography. · Ming and Qing Dynasty Architecture Museum: The village preserves 39 ancient buildings from the Ming and Qing dynasties, distributed along three mountain slopes. It is one of the best-preserved ancient villages in Fujian Province. Historical sites include the Cai Ancestral Temple, Cai Clan Ancestral Hall, and Shiyin Bridge, offering a time-travel experience. · Immersive Ancient Village Life Experience: Stay in traditional ancient houses, try on Hanfu costumes, and shoot a series of classical-style photos in the century-old village. The village’s "Hundred-Table Banquet" lets you taste authentic farmhouse dishes and experience local hospitality. 🗓️ Basic Information Location: Northeast of Yangzhong Town, Youxi County, Sanming City, Fujian Province Altitude: 550 meters Climate: Suitable for travel year-round Recommended Visit Duration: 1-2 hours or a day trip 🏞️ Main Attractions 1. Autumn Drying Scenery: Best viewed from September to November, this is the most distinctive feature of Guifeng Village. 2. Cai Clan Ancestral Hall: Built during the Kangxi period of the Qing Dynasty to commemorate Cai Maoxiang, the first imperial scholar from Guifeng, located above Shiyin Bridge. A must-visit to understand the Cai family culture. 3. Stone Street District: Unique stone-paved alleys in Guifeng Village, winding and secluded, with all paths paved in stone, creating a distinctive street surface. 4. Cai Ancestral Temple: Originally built during the Song and Yuan dynasties, it is the earliest ancestral temple of the Cai family. The large-scale building features two small wells behind it, known as the "Dragon Eyes." 5. Stone Lion House: Built during the Jiaqing period of the Qing Dynasty, named for the exquisite stone lion inside, showcasing splendid stone carving art. 6. Houmen Mountain Mansion: Nicknamed the "Little Potala Palace" due to its resemblance to the Potala Palace, it has produced many scholars. 🍜 Specialty Food and Shopping · Food Recommendations: · Guifeng Tofu: A local specialty with a rich bean flavor. · Hundred-Table Banquet: Offers 15 authentic farmhouse dishes including Yangzhong herbal soup and white-cut chicken; check event times in advance. · Guifeng Yellow Wine: Brewed using the Cai family’s ancestral techniques for over 700 years, it has a sweet, mellow, and refreshing taste. 💰 Practical Travel Information Admission: 20 RMB for Guifeng Ancient Village Scenic Area (Note: some sources indicate free entry; please verify before your trip). Opening Hours: 8:00 AM - 6:00 PM. Transportation: · Self-drive: Navigate to "Guifeng Ancient Village." From Fuzhou, it’s about 110 km, approximately 1.5 hours. · High-speed train: Arrive at Youxi High-speed Rail Station, then travel 59 km to Guifeng Ancient Village. · Bus: Arrive at Yangzhong Town, Youxi County, then travel 13.5 km to Guifeng Ancient Village. Best Season to Visit: Suitable year-round, but the autumn drying scenery from September to November is most unique. Accommodation: Several ancient house guesthouses are available in the village; booking in advance is recommended. Special Tips: Guifeng Village is crowded during holidays; consider visiting during off-peak times. The stone-paved roads can be slippery due to moss; wear non-slip shoes. 💎 Travel Tips 1. Guifeng Village is known for "every house has culture, and history fills the streets." Visitors interested in ancient architecture can hire local guides for explanations. 2. To experience traditional opera culture, check for occasional performances of Xiaoqu Opera and Min Opera held in the village. 3. Early morning is the best time to photograph the autumn drying scenery and village mist, with excellent light and shadow effects.

Guifeng Village – A Fun Persimmon-Picking Experience I joined a one-day tour to Guifeng Village through a travel agency near Beijing Road, and it turned out to be such a fun and memorable trip. Guifeng Village is surrounded by beautiful nature and is especially famous for its persimmons. The best part of the visit was picking fresh persimmons straight from the trees. It was a simple but really enjoyable experience — relaxing, fun, and it gave me a real taste of village life. The locals also make various persimmon products, such as dried persimmons and persimmon snacks, and they were all very delicious! Guifeng Village is a lovely place to slow down, enjoy nature, and bring home some sweet memories (and maybe a few persimmons too!). A great choice for a refreshing day trip outside the city.
